The Impact of Gaming on Mental Health

As the digital landscape continues to evolve, the intersection of online gaming and mental health has become a critical discussion. In recent years, platforms like Donbet have risen to prominence, drawing attention not only for their technological sophistication but also for their impact on users' mental well-being.

In 2025, the impact of prolonged gaming on mental health is a topic that has garnered considerable debate. Many users of platforms such as Donbet enjoy the competitive and strategic aspects of gaming, which can offer stimulating cognitive exercises and social connections. These platforms offer a sense of community and achievement, which can have positive effects on players by providing an avenue for stress relief and social interaction.

However, mental health professionals and researchers have raised concerns about the potential negative impact of excessive gaming. Addiction, social withdrawal, and the blurring of real-life and gaming success can contribute to anxiety and depression. The immersive nature of games designed with intricate reward systems can sometimes lead individuals to prioritize online interactions over real-life engagements, leading to significant consequences for their mental health.

In the global arena, the conversation around gaming addiction has prompted various countries to introduce regulatory measures. In Asia, some nations have implemented strict curfews on gaming for younger users to mitigate the risks associated with excessive screen time. Such measures reflect a growing recognition of the need to balance digital engagement with personal well-being.

Organizations at the forefront of mental health advocacy have been highlighting the importance of understanding the nuances of gaming culture and its effects. Initiatives are underway to promote healthy gaming habits and develop strategies to identify individuals at risk of developing unhealthy gaming behaviors early on. Furthermore, researchers are exploring how gaming platforms can incorporate features that encourage positive mental health practices, like setting time limits and promoting breaks.

As we delve deeper into 2025, the dialogue surrounding gaming and mental health remains complex and multifaceted. It underscores a broader societal need to cultivate an environment where technology serves as a tool for enhancement, not detriment. By fostering an informed approach to gaming, leveraging the potential for education and social connection while mitigating its risks, we can pave the way for healthier interactions in the digital world.
